North County New Business News: Open To The Public

There's been a recent explosion of restaurants in Encinitas lately- from Haggo's to Solterra to Buffalo Wild Wings to Café Ipe to Union to the Bier Garden- it's something for everyone. Next up to the plate is Priority Public House in the old Calypso location at 576 North Coast Highway 101 in Encinitas.
Back in the 70's, restaurants that were dark and dingy and secretive (think Studio 54) were all the rage. Now that we've hit the millennium, open, bright, and breezy is the way to go. Priority Public House fits that bill as everyone window is open and there's lots of light inside.
Manager Chris Balfour gave me a quick tour today and let me know the aim of Public was to have a relaxed feeling with the décor and layout- definitely not plastic and sterile. It's a good mix inside- along with the open windows they used a lot of wood and weathered metal. Besides the cool interior, the food is also a focal point. Chris mentioned chef Mark Dowen was brought on to serve up unique plates- such as crab and smoked gouda mac-n-cheese as well as this 'inside out' jalapeno jack cheese burger thing that I just butchered in this blog- basically you need to go down there and have it for yourself. The menu is also evolving Chris said based on local's preferences. And if you have a special request for a certain beer- they'll try to work it in to the menu for you. Not a bad deal.
So where did the idea of Public Priority House come from? It's the vision of Brian and Megan McBride from Encinitas. Brian was tired of the corporate life and always wanted to own a restaurant. When Calypso was looking for a buyer, the McBrides jumped at the chance. Now that they're open- support your local business this weekend! They're open Tuesday at 4pm and Wednesday to Sunday at 11am.
